From d48602a5f3dade3c1800b3e3d11ad09a45a761a2 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Nirbheek Chauhan Date: Thu, 26 Sep 2024 14:56:34 +0530 Subject: [PATCH] curses: Ignore /usr/bin/ncurses5.4-config on macOS macOS mistakenly ships /usr/bin/ncurses5.4-config and a man page for it, but none of the headers or libraries are available in the location advertised by it. Ignore /usr/bin because it can only contain this broken configtool script. Homebrew is /usr/local or /opt/homebrew. Xcode's command-line tools SDK does include curses, but the configtool in there is wrong too, and anyway we can't just randomly pick it up since the user must explicitly select that as a target by using a native file. The MacOSX SDK itself does not include curses. We also can't ignore ncurses5.4-config entirely because it might be available in a different prefix. --- mesonbuild/dependencies/misc.py | 9 ++++++++- 1 file changed, 8 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-) diff --git a/mesonbuild/dependencies/misc.py b/mesonbuild/dependencies/misc.py index b5c40984a..4815e1c18 100644 --- a/mesonbuild/dependencies/misc.py +++ b/mesonbuild/dependencies/misc.py @@ -312,7 +312,14 @@ class CursesConfigToolDependency(ConfigToolDependency): tools = ['ncursesw6-config', 'ncursesw5-config', 'ncurses6-config', 'ncurses5-config', 'ncurses5.4-config'] def __init__(self, name: str, env: 'Environment', kwargs: T.Dict[str, T.Any], language: T.Optional[str] = None): - super().__init__(name, env, kwargs, language) + exclude_paths = None + # macOS mistakenly ships /usr/bin/ncurses5.4-config and a man page for + # it, but none of the headers or libraries.
